Skip to content
Snippets Groups Projects
Commit b14975c2 authored by Ladislav Lhotka's avatar Ladislav Lhotka
Browse files

Fix insert_before and insert_after.

parent 44699916
No related branches found
No related tags found
No related merge requests found
Pipeline #
......@@ -10,7 +10,7 @@ def contents(*filenames):
setup(
name = "yangson",
packages = ["yangson"],
version = "0.1.36",
version = "0.1.37",
description = "Library for working with YANG schemas and data",
author = "Ladislav Lhotka",
author_email = "lhotka@nic.cz",
......
......@@ -339,8 +339,8 @@ class Instance:
try:
cr = self.crumb
return Instance(value,
EntryCrumb(cr.before, [self.value] + cr.after, cr,
datetime.now()))
EntryCrumb(cr.before, [self.value] + cr.after,
cr.parent, datetime.now()))
except (AttributeError, IndexError):
raise InstanceTypeError(self, "insert before non-entry") from None
......@@ -348,8 +348,8 @@ class Instance:
try:
cr = self.crumb
return Instance(value,
EntryCrumb(cr.before + [self.value], cr.after, cr,
datetime.now()))
EntryCrumb(cr.before + [self.value], cr.after,
cr.parent, datetime.now()))
except (AttributeError, IndexError):
raise InstanceTypeError(self, "insert after non-entry") from None
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ment